6 advantages of home appliance warranty plans

6 advantages of home appliance warranty plans

Home appliance warranty plans are typically annual plans that offer coverage for replacing and repairing some of the major appliances and systems in the house. For this, a homeowner has to pay an annual fee that usually starts from a few hundred dollars and may go to over $1000, depending on the plan. The cost also includes the service charge of the professional technician visiting the house to evaluate the appliance’s repair and maintenance.

Benefits of home appliance warranty plans

Get financial protection
The cost of repairing or replacing home appliances can turn out to be quite high. Besides, an unexpected breakdown of a system of appliances at home can disrupt one’s budget. A home appliance warranty plan works well in such situations. It offers the necessary financial protection by covering most of the cost of repairs and replacements for covered systems and appliances. So, instead of paying hefty replacement or repair bills or needing to purchase a new appliance, a homeowner can be assured that the warranty plan will cover all the expenses.

Save more money with flat-rate fixes
New homeowners usually depend on a home inspection team to determine the condition of kitchen appliances, water heaters, washers and dryers, and so on. But even an expert and highly experienced home inspector might miss some underlying issues that may require repairs later on . With a home warranty, one can save a significant amount of money by taking benefit of flat-rate fixes offered by these plans. When there is a flat-rate fix, a service provider will repair or replace an appliance for a fee that has been decided while signing up for the warranty.

Get some peace of mind
With a home appliance warranty, a homeowner can be assured that they have protection against any unexpected replacements or repairs that might be required for some of the systems and appliances in the house. This is especially beneficial for those who are on a tight budget and are concerned about the potential cost of replacement and repair.

Extended coverage for older appliances
Most manufacturers offer warranties that are valid only for a limited period. But appliance warranty plans offer coverage for appliances and systems that go beyond the typical warranty period the manufacturer provides. This can be quite beneficial for homeowners who own older appliances, which are more likely to need repair or replacement.

Save time and efforts
A home warranty plan often offers the convenience of handling the process of hiring an experienced professional technician for the repair and replacement work. So, a homeowner does not have to worry about finding the right service provider, contacting them, and negotiating fees to do the work. This saves one a lot of time and effort.

Increase in the value of the house
A home warranty covers the replacement and repair of appliances and systems in the house. So, having such a plan is often reassuring for potential homebuyers. It indicates to them that they do not have to bear the burden of extra cost if any of the appliances break down after the sale of the house. This invariably increases the house’s overall value, making it more attractive to new buyers.

How to distinguish between heartburn and GERD

Heartburn is an unpleasant, burning sensation in the chest that is more common than a lot of individuals realize. Pregnant women, older men, and even young adults experience it frequently. Despite it being such a prevalent experience, not many know that heartburn has actually nothing to do with the heart and everything to do with the stomach and the esophagus. Unsurprisingly enough, heartburn is also used interchangeably with GERD. But, before we get to deciphering heartburn and GERD, let’s understand what acid reflux is. What is acid reflux or GER? Acid reflux occurs when the lower esophageal sphincter or LES becomes weak, allowing the contents of the stomach to travel in the wrong direction, back up the esophagus. Acid reflux is also called GER or gastroesophageal reflux as it involves the stomach and esophagus. This condition can usually be resolved with over-the-counter medication. What is heartburn? Heartburn is a burning or painful sensation that is experienced in the chest. Since the lining of the esophagus is not as strong as the lining of the stomach, the acid from the stomach can cause a burning sensation in the chest. This pain or burning sensation that is heartburn can often be misconstrued for a heart attack.

5 common joint conditions and how to treat them

A joint or articulation is made from two bones that aid the body in movement. There are many forms of joint conditions, which, in many cases, arise from the wear and tear of bones. Arthritis is one of the major and most common health conditions in the country, and its intensity increases with age. Here are some common types of joint conditions that you need to know: Osteoarthritis With almost 10 percent of men and 13 percent of women aged over 60 suffering from osteoarthritis, it is one of the most prevalent joint conditions in the country. Osteoarthritis occurs due to the wear and tear of the cartilages that protect the ends of bones. It commonly affects joints of the spine, hands, hips, and knees. If left untreated, this wear and tear of the cartilage soon leads to bone degeneration, thereby affecting flexibility and range of movement. Treatment for osteoarthritis depends on its severity and the patient’s age. Mild symptoms can be treated through medications, physiotherapy, and changes in lifestyle, whereas moderate to severe cases may require surgical intervention. Spondyloarthritis Spondyloarthritis, also referred to as spondyloarthropathy, is a type of rheumatic disease that causes inflammation in various joints. There are two types of spondyloarthritis—axial spondyloarthritis, which causes inflammation of the joints in the chest, spine, and hip bone, and peripheral spondyloarthritis, which causes inflammation in the fingers, knees, and toes.
